Latest Patents

Asai holds a patent for an "Optical displacement measuring system with nonlinearity correction." This system utilizes triangulation to measure distances accurately. It features a light receiving mechanism that captures light reflected from an object, generating output signals that correspond to the position of a light spot. The system includes operational means for processing these signals and a linearity correcting mechanism to ensure accurate measurements.
